"Multivariate Analysis: Beyond the Surface" provides an in-depth exploration of advanced multivariate techniques, as well as a thorough introduction to the fundamental principles and concepts of multivariate analysis.
The book present a wide range of multivariate analysis methods, including exploratory factor analysis, structural equation modeling, latent growth curve modeling, and multilevel modeling. It also cover topics such as Bayesian methods, robust methods, and nonlinear multivariate techniques.
In addition to discussing the theoretical underpinnings of these methods, the book provides practical guidance on how to implement them in real-world settings. It is richly illustrated with examples and case studies from a variety of fields, including psychology, sociology, education, and business.
"Multivariate Analysis: Beyond the Surface" is an invaluable resource for researchers and practitioners in any field where multivariate analysis is used, including social and behavioral sciences, medicine, economics, and engineering. Whether you are a novice or an experienced researcher, this book will deepen your understanding of multivariate analysis and provide you with the tools you need to conduct sophisticated analyses of complex data sets.
